I have a windows 10 systems that I just loaded 8.0M2 driver and everything works fine. But as soon as i reboot I get BSOD or restart that there is an issue and Windows cannot start. Only way to get get system to restart is by resetting Windows or using restore point of right before I installed Display Link..

System is MSI Dominator Pro Laptop
NVidia GeForce GTX 980M

Any ideas on what could be causing the issue and a possible fix??

Have also tried the 7.9M7 driver with the same results, works great on install but on reboot causes BSOD and windows will not load unless I us "reset Windows" or boot from my restore point..
